About the Role

The incumbent will support the day-to-day management of NEP's IT systems, provide specialised support to escalated issues, collaborate with the broader technology teams, actively participate as a key resource in organisational projects, work closely with 3rd party vendors and continually innovate to improve organisational productivity, capability, and service levels.

This position will ideally suit a candidate with a solid experience in a system administration role supporting VMware, HP, Nimble, Windows & Linux Servers, Hybrid Active Directory, Citrix, Veeam, Exchange Online, OKTA, SQL and some scripting experience.

Key Responsibilities but not limited to:
  • Install, configure, and maintain server hardware and software.
  • Monitor system performance and troubleshoot issues promptly.
  • Ensure the effectiveness of data backup and recovery processes.
  • Collaborate with local and international teams as required.
  • Adhere to internal procedures including security protocols, change control, and incident management.
  • Assist in planning and executing IT projects and upgrades.
  • Serve as an escalation point for First Level Support Staff.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Required skills and attributes:
  • Experience deploying and supporting Windows Server
  • Experience administering Active Directory
  • Experience administering Exchange Online
  • Experience administering switches
  • Proficiency with VMWare
  • Proficiency with PowerShell
  • Bachelor's degree in computer science or equivalent experience.
  • Familiarity with Okta or other IAM platforms.
  • Able to work autonomously.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Strong time and task management abilities with keen attention to detail.
  • Team-building skills with excellent interpersonal abilities.

NEP is the largest media technology partner for content producers of live sports, entertainment, and corporate events globally. For more than 35 years, NEP has been delivering innovative products and services that enable clients to make, manage and show the world their content—anywhere, anytime, on any platform.

As a trusted partner working on some of the largest productions in the world, NEP offers a complete set of end-to-end solutions, from content capture to distribution—including a growing portfolio of transformational cloud-based, software-based and virtualized technologies.

• NEP’s Live Production solutions range from AV services and live audience enhancements to traditional outside broadcast and cutting-edge centralized and cloud production.

• NEP’s Virtual Production solutions start at the creative stage and end with exceptional execution across ICVFX, augmented reality, LED stages and more.

• NEP’s Media Processing solutions provide the tools and products our clients need to ingest, edit, store, search, manage and distribute their digital assets to rights holders across multiple platforms.

Headquartered in the United States, NEP has operations in 25 countries with over 4,000+ employees. Together, NEP has supported productions in over 100 countries on all seven continents and is still growing. Clients range from the leaders in sport, music, film and TV, to major corporate brands, agencies, to new content owners and creators all around the world.
